Find the smallest non-zero whole number that is
divisible by 315, 378 and 392.

Answer:

52920

Explanation:

You have described the Least Common Multiple (LCM) of the three numbers. That can be found by considering their unique factors. The LCM is the product of the unique factors, 2³, 3³, 5, 7².

315 = 3×3×5×7

378 = 2×3×3×3×7

392 = 2×2×2×7×7

The LCM will be ...

2×2×2×3×3×3×5×7×7 = 52920

The smallest natural number divisible by 314, 378, and 392 is 52920.
